Open Systems Appoints Dennis Monner as New CEO to Lead Future Growth Strategies

Open Systems Transitions Leadership for Future Growth



Open Systems, a prominent name in Managed SASE (Secure Access Service Edge) solutions, has announced a significant leadership change as it embarks on its next phase of growth. As of October 1, 2025, Dennis Monner will take over the reins as Chief Executive Officer, succeeding Daniel Neuhaus. Neuhaus, who has been instrumental in shaping the company’s strategic direction since 2023, expressed pride in the progress the organization has made during his tenure.

Dennis Monner brings over 25 years of extensive experience in cybersecurity, cloud services, and networking to his new role. Having founded successful firms such as Gateprotect and Secucloud, which garnered significant attention in the security sector, Monner's expertise will be invaluable as Open Systems aims to magnify its market presence in the ever-evolving landscape of digital security.

“I am thrilled to join Open Systems at such a pivotal moment,” stated Monner. “The company has built a robust foundation thanks to its exceptional technology and unwavering focus on customer satisfaction. With vast opportunities ahead, I am eager to work alongside our talented team to amplify our market impact and drive innovation.”

Under Neuhaus’s leadership, Open Systems experienced considerable growth, expanding its product offerings and undergoing a strategic acquisition by Swiss Post. Neuhaus joined Open Systems after the acquisition of his previous company, Sqooba. His multifaceted roles transitioned from Chief Product Officer to Chief Technology Officer and, ultimately, CEO. Throughout his journey, he aligned product strategies with technological advancement while prioritizing customer engagement, ensuring the company’s resiliency amid complex cybersecurity challenges.

“The groundwork we laid over the past several years has been crucial for our global expansion,” Neuhaus reflected. “I am immensely proud of our team and how our efforts have been recognized externally, including being named a Great Place to Work for three consecutive years. This journey has been extraordinary, and I am confident that Dennis will elevate Open Systems to new heights.”

Daniel Gerber, Chairman of the Board, acknowledged the efforts put forth by Neuhaus, praising his leadership and vision as critical drivers in making Open Systems a front-runner in the cybersecurity sector. “With the support of Swiss Post and under Dennis's entrepreneurial leadership, we are set to further accelerate our growth. By leveraging innovations such as AI, we aim to enhance our capabilities and expand our global reach,” Gerber remarked.

About Open Systems


Open Systems is a leading provider of native Managed SASE solutions, combining network and security capabilities on a cloud-native platform. Founded in 1990 and headquartered in Zurich, the Swiss cybersecurity firm supports clients worldwide through a customer-centric service model that delivers 24/7 expert support. With a focus on ensuring secure and efficient network operations, Open Systems continues to empower organizations in navigating the complexities of today's IT environments.
